On August 02 2014 00:11 amazingxkcd wrote:
I would like to main sagat. Does anyone have a good starting guide or resources for him?


I main Sagat. I don't have any resources except the Sagat forums on SRK (which should have everything you need).

I'm not great by any means but some things I've learned are:

- You will win most games by spamming fireballs at long and medium ranges and punishing jumpins.

- The fw.HK combo after a counterhit Tiger Uppercut is your best friend. Super easy to do and you will use it a lot. You will realize quickly that juggling into ultra after the fw.HK is also very easy. This might be one of the easiest high damage combos you can perform in this game.

- Throw fireballs and randomly put in a jab or short to bait jumpins and then proceed to do the combo above

- Some good normals to check out are st.HK at medium range, cr.HP at medium range, cr.MK at any range and st.LK at any range.

I know three combos, the one I mentioned above, a jumpin or punish BNB (I do st.MP into Tiger Uppercut or Knee sometimes) and cr.MK into Tiger Shot.

This is literally everything I ever do with Sagat. If I get cornered and need to get out I just try to land a knockdown somehow. Sagat doesn't just flee from anyone with his worthless dashes.

I can't do FADC into Ultra consistently yet, but aside from that I don't know of anything else noteworthy about Sagat to be honest. He isn't quite as complicated as some of the cast is

EDIT: Also I think his focus attack is awful, I'd use it sparingly (unless for FADC that is).

On August 01 2014 00:41 Aylear wrote:
[image loading]

The Hitbox Arcade (above) uses a layout that takes time to get used to at first (jump is the bottom-most button? wat), but it's way better than using something like WASD for movement. Reason being you don't have natural access to all the directional buttons at the same time if you use WASD -- to press jump, you have to take your finger off the S key, and a 360 motion (or any motion that includes both down and jump) is this really weird mesh of button presses.

If you put jump on space bar instead of W, your left hand can press all of them simultaneously. I can pull of a 720 very quickly by just rolling the button presses in a very natural way. Like I said, your brain will go "wtf" at first but it makes complete sense.



I'm gonna try this out . I wanna learn hugo and I already use kb because my stick is broken (got a multimeter but not sure how to test/fix it exactly). All I ever did was add a spring and swap out a gate when it was new.

Problem on KB though is you have ghosting shit.

Right now I use wasd and 789 456 and the issue is with holding 8+5 (FA) and dash cancel left with A doesn't register. Previously I had been using 456 123 but then down left and 3 wouldnt register.

So I'm thinking maybe I should just swap to some middle letters like fgh or something and use spacebar like hitbox style. If anyone else wants to try something make sure you test out your inputs with this:

http://www.microsoft.com/appliedsciences/content/projects/KeyboardGhostingDemo.aspx

because its a pain in the ass to try and acclimate to something new only to find out a day or so later that it's got bugs and have to try a whole new setup.
